The IELTS General Writing course is a six-lesson program designed to equip you with the skills necessary to write successfully. Our course is guaranteed to boost your IELTS Writing score by meeting all four assessment criteria: Task Achievement, Coherence and Cohesion, Lexical Resource and Grammatical Resource and Accuracy.
Task Achievement. You will learn how to choose the correct register/tone (formal, informal, semi-formal), study the corresponding features of each one, and ultimately improve your writing by producing different types of letters. You will also practice writing proper-sized letters within the timeframe and addressing all parts of the letter.
Coherence and Cohesion. Follow the easy-to-follow organization patterns provided to enable readers to follow the flow of your ideas in the letters.
Lexical Resource. You will receive a range of appropriate vocabulary to remember and use with different types of letters.
Grammatical Resource and Accuracy. Apply simple, complex, and compound grammatical structures correctly in writing to increase your IELTS score.
In this IELTS General Writing course, you will learn to avoid common mistakes in letter writing. After each lesson, you will be offered hands-on activities in the workbook to practice based on the lesson materials. It is always a good idea to recap your workbook before your exam. Best of luck!
